The game over the Strait of Hormuz between Iran and the U.S. is approaching a dangerous tipping point, and military conflict is escalating again

BlockBeats report: On July 13, US officials said that the US military carried out several strikes about an hour earlier on missile and air defense systems at several locations around the Strait of Hormuz, as well as on small boats of Iran’s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ps. An official from Qeshm Island confirmed that local time on Sunday afternoon, the enemy fired a total of 10 to 11 missiles at Qeshm Island. All targets hit were military facilities, and the attack caused no casualties.

Earlier, Iran said it carried out an attack on a US missile launch base in Kuwait. Facilities housing ATACMS missile systems at the US military base in Kuwait were hit, and thick smoke rose at the scene.

Meanwhile, according to Lebanon’s National News Agency (NNA), Israeli artillery carried out more shelling in southern Lebanon. Two Israeli shells hit the town of Kfar Taybunut in the Nabatieh district in southern Lebanon. The statement also added that the attack originated from positions of Israeli forces in the occupied border area. In addition, Israel shelled the town of Zau’ta al-Sharkiya near Meifadun.
